The is a highly popular, budget-friendly mini LED projector widely praised for its 800-lumen output, vibrant TFT LCD display, and compact design. While it serves as an excellent entry-level home theater device, its built-in software can occasionally run into bugs, playback lag, or aspect ratio inconsistencies over time. Installing a UNIC UC40 projector software update download new firmware file is the most effective way to eliminate UI glitches, improve audio-video synchronization, and enhance media format compatibility via USB.

Disclaimer: Unic UC40 is a discontinued model in some markets. Always verify that any firmware you download is intended for your specific device revision (UC40 vs UC40+). The manufacturer is not liable for damage caused by incorrect firmware installation.

If your projector is still functioning perfectly fine, it is highly recommended to leave the existing firmware alone. If you are unsatisfied with the device's capabilities, using external adapters or upgrading to a newer, native smart projector will yield vastly better results with zero risk of breaking your device.
